By: Melville Brooks, director of Talent Management, Omega Healthcare Philippines

Women have made significant strides in the workplace, contributing their skills, leadership, and innovation across industries, particularly in healthcare. Ensuring they have an environment where they can thrive is both a moral responsibility and a strategic advantage.
In the Philippines, women make up a substantial portion of the workforce, with approximately 21.9 million employed as of December 2023, according to the Philippine Statistics Authority (PSA). This underscores the importance of prioritizing gender diversity and empowerment to attract and retain talent while fostering collaboration, productivity, and long-term business success.

Promote equal opportunities
Creating a workplace where women can thrive includes ensuring equal opportunities, making it essential for organizations to implement policies that promote gender equality. This includes fair hiring practices, equal access to career development, and leadership opportunities. At Omega Healthcare, these principles are embedded in our workplace culture. For instance, the company has a strict non-discrimination policy in recruitment that focuses on candidates' skills and potential rather than personal characteristics.
Beyond recruitment, the company actively works to eliminate biases in performance evaluations and career advancement. This commitment to equity is reflected in its workforce, which includes 1,433 women and 999 men. Notably, women are steadily making strides in leadership, with 27 holding leadership positions alongside 42 men. Omega Healthcare is actively fostering an environment where more women can rise to leadership roles and drive meaningful contributions to the organization.
Provide access to training and talent development programs
Training and talent development programs are essential for enhancing individual performance and career growth. Ensuring that women have access to structured learning opportunities equips them with the skills, knowledge, and confidence to excel in their roles and advance into leadership positions. Through continuous training, upskilling initiatives, and career development programs, organizations can empower women to overcome barriers and reach their full potential.
At Omega Healthcare, employees have equal access to a wide array of training programs—from those designed for new hires to leadership development initiatives. The company offers comprehensive training tailored to employees’ specific roles, whether in patient interaction, medical coding, nursing, or other specialized fields. For employees with leadership potential, Omega Healthcare provides specialized development programs, including the High Potential (HiPo) training program, which enhances expertise in quality, operations, and training.
To support leadership readiness, Omega Healthcare offers structured programs such as the First Time Leader Program, which helps employees transition from individual contributors to team leaders, and the Lead the Leader Program, which equips first-time managers with the skills needed to lead frontline leaders effectively. By fostering an inclusive learning environment where women have equal access to professional development, organizations can cultivate a culture of innovation, improve decision-making, and build a stronger, more diverse workforce.
Ensure supportive workplace policies and fair employee benefits
Supportive workplace policies and fair employee benefits help women balance their professional and personal responsibilities while maintaining their well-being. Organizations that prioritize inclusive policies foster a culture of empowerment and demonstrate a commitment to employee support. At Omega Healthcare, workplace policies promote work-life balance, including a breastfeeding policy that provides dedicated facilities and support for nursing mothers. Work schedules are also structured to prevent excessive overtime, with any additional work planned in advance and fairly compensated. This allows women, especially those with families, to manage their careers while fulfilling personal responsibilities.
Beyond these policies, Omega Healthcare offers a comprehensive benefits package, including HMO coverage with dependents, group life and accident insurance, compensatory time off, bereavement assistance, annual appraisals, and free flu vaccinations. Women employees also receive legally mandated benefits such as vacation and sick leave, Special Leave Benefits for Women (Magna Carta of Women), Maternity Leave, Parental Leave for Solo Parents, and Leave for Victims of Violence, among others. By providing these policies and benefits, Omega Healthcare ensures that women have the support they need to thrive both professionally and personally.
